Pakistan - Re-Export of Insecticides

At $656,908.88 in 2018, the country was ranked number 8 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Insecticides. Pakistan is overtaken by Trinidad and Tobago, which was ranked number 7 at $1,458,004 and is followed by Saudi Arabia at $216,492.98. United States lead the ranking with $46,395,971.15 in 2019, that is a decrease of 6.4% compared to 2018. United Arab Emirates, Italy and Jordan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kenya recorded the best 5 years average growth at +327.3% per year, while Guyana witnessed the worst performance at -68.9% per year.
